2008/09 Kress Fellowship in Art Librarianship at Yale University

 

The Kress Fellowship is intended for a recent graduate from library school
who wishes to pursue a career in art librarianship. Through this fellowship,
the Kress Foundation seeks to achieve in the field of art librarianship what
it has accomplished for art history and art conservation: ensuring the
growth of the discipline by promoting the advancement of new professionals. 

 

This year the focus of the Kress Fellowship will be on all aspects of public
services in the arts, which will include experience in providing reference,
instruction, and outreach as well as designing and undertaking an innovative
exploration of a specific aspect of these services. During their tenure at
Yale Kress Fellows are expected to pursue a mutually agreed-upon project
resulting in a publishable paper or a new library service. Kress Fellows are
also introduced to a broad spectrum of professional activities beyond public
services and will have the opportunity to perform collection development
activities, interact with a variety of special collections, and participate
in the work of library committees and external professional organizations.
